Le créateur de règles de la Thombox

Mercredi, 13 Novembre 2013 06:00 Domotics
Imprimer
Note des utilisateurs: / 14
MauvaisTrès bien 

Je vous propose de voir en détail comment fonctionne la Thombox et notamment son créateur de règles. En reprenant mon article de la semaine passée, sur comment interfacer une Zipabox à une IPX800 pour ouvrir son garage, nous allons découvrir comment celà se configure sur la Thombox.

Thombox

Pour ouvrir mon garage, j'utilise ma carte IP Relais IPX800 de chez GCE. Il est possible de piloter cette carte en envoyant des commandes HTTP pour activer chaque relai. C'est de cette façon que je vais coupler mon IPX800 à ma Thombox.

IPX800

Mon garage possède un automatisme Somfy qu'on peut utiliser avec sa télécommande, mais on peut aussi le commander via un contact sec. Ce contact peut être connecté à mon IPX800 pour prendre le contrôle de mon portail. En fait, il devient un objet communicant !

Somfy

Ensuite je me connecte à ma Thombox pour configurer mes périphériques et ma règle de commande. La Thombox est une box dérivée de la Zipabox. vous retrouverez la même interface, sauf que les couleurs et les boutons ont été revues.

La Thombox ne fonctionne pas en Zwave. Elle met en oeuvre le protocole Advisen (propriétaire), ce qui lui ouvre la porte aux nombreux périphériques de ce dernier.

Les écrans sont traduits en Français, bien qu'il reste encore quelques libellés qui paraissent en Anglais. Je pense que celà sera corrigé dans les futures versions.

Pour commencer le paramétrage, il faut créer deux périphériques virtuels. Dans la barre du haut, cliquez GENERAL pour accéder aux boutons de création.

Barre des fonctions

Dans la fenêtre qui s'ouvre, vous voyez le nombre de périphériques existants. Vous pouvez cliquer sur Ajouter des modules pour ajouter des modules physiques (existant pour de vrai!) ou cliquer sur Ajouter des modules virtuels pour ajouter des modules qui n'existent pas. Ce dernier cas est particulièrement utile pour créer des boutons de commande.

Paramètres Généraux

Pour mon article, j'ai besoin de deux boutons virtuels :

- Présence à la maison ? ==>> Indiquera si quelqu'un est à la maison

- Ouverture / Fermeture du portail ==>> Lancera une action d'ouverture ou de fermeture.

 

Créez deux Virtual Switchs (bouton virtuel) pour ces deux besoins.

Créer un périphérique virtuel

Sélectionnez le type (Il est encore en Anglais ;-( ).

Bouton Virtuel

Entrez le nom de votre bouton.

Présent à la maison

Le module est maintenant créé.

Module Sauvé

Renouvelez la même opération pour la commande Ouvrir/Fermer portail.

Voilà ce que çà donne lorsque l'on revient sur l'interface principale. Le widget Confort est mis à jour. On y trouve ici, une prise (module physique) et 3 modules virtuels.

Commandes

 

Il faut maintenant passer dans le créateur de règles pour configurer le comportement de la Thombox. Pour l'activer, il faut cliquer sur le bouton "Créateur de règles" en haut à droite.

La règle que je vais créer est le même que dans le précédent article, sauf que j'ai rajouter une deuxième condition, pour vérifier que quelqu'un est à la maison avant d'ouvrir le garage. J'ai aussi une nouvelle action qui envoie un mail à chaque activation de la porte. Ca peut paraitre lourd, mais il ne faut pas hésiter à ajouter des alertes sur les ouvertures critiques de votre maison.

Nouvelle règle

Reprenons cette règle. Il faut mettre un opérateur "et" avec deux capteurs. Chaque capteur (en bleu) doit prendre un des deux modules virtuels que nous venons de créer (ici on les voit avec http en vert). Pour lancer l'ouverture, il faut mettre cette condition dans une boucle "Quand" qui lance différentes actions.

Le premier capteur se déclenche sur On ou Off. En fait, c'est la même commande pour ouvrir ou pour fermer la porte.

Quand / et

Le second capteur bloque la règle si personne n'est à la maison. Il faut le mettre sur On pour filtrer les évènements lorsque personne n'est présent.

Condition Virtual Switch

Il faut envoyer 3 commandes HTTP pour ouvrir le portail. Voici la requête que j'utilise. Led8=0 signifie qu'on ouvre le relai 8 de la carte IPX. Led8=1 signifie qu'on ferme le relai 8.

Paramètre IPX

Sur la commande envoi_message, il faut configurer le mail que vous souhaitez envoyer sur ouverture de la porte.

Paramètrage de l'email

Pour finir, il faut sauver la règle.

Sauvegardé

Synchroniser les règles vers le cloud de la Thombox.

Synchroniser les règles

Patienter jusqu'à la fin, celà dure quelques secondes.

Synchro en cours

Enfin, il faut revenir sur le dashboard pour tester. Mettez la présence à On puis activer la porte avec la commande Ouvrir / Fermer le portail.

Commandes

Le portail est fermé.

Portail fermé

Le portail est ouvert.

Portail Ouvert

Un exemple du mail qu'on reçoit dans les quelques secondes.

Mail d'ouverture

La Thombox trace tous les évènements. En utilisant le Widget Evènement, vous pouvez retracer ce qu'il s'est passé dans votre maison.

Evènements

Le plus pratique, c'est d'utiliser l'application mobile pour ouvrir le garage lorsque vous rentrez chez vous. Connectez vous avec votre login Thombox (le même que sur le PC).

Connexion à l'application mobile

Vous arrivez au menu des fonctions.

Menu

Vous pouvez consulter les évènements comme sur le navigateur web de votre PC.

Evènements

La section "Lampes et Appareils" correspond à la section Confort de l'interface Web/PC. Vous retrouvez les commandes vues précédemment. Vous pouvez ouvrir votre garage ... On ne voit pas ici les libellés On/Off mais elles fonctionnent. Probablement que ce point sera bientôt corrigé par les équipes de Zipato.

Commandes mobiles

La Thombox possède un firmware équivalent à la Zipabox. On peut donc implémenter les mêmes règles. Aucun souci à ce faire de ce coté là. Le fait d'utiliser une box Thomson permet d'accéder à un ensemble box + documentation en Français + modules Advisen à bas prix, c'est rassurant pour un certain public qui cherche des repères et du support.

Thomson a fait le choix de la technologie Zipato, ce qui laisse un espoir de voir de nouveaux protocoles arriver : 433Mhz, KNX, EnOcean ... De ce coté, il n'y a pas encore de roadmap, pour l'instant je n'ai pas vu communication officielle.

Vous n'avez pas compris un point ? Vous vous posez une question ? Vous pouvez nous contacter via le bouton Assistance sur votre gauche. N'hésitez pas à demander un rendez-vous téléphonique avec Domotics.

Vous avez aimé cet article ? Vous pouvez le partager sur vos réseaux sociaux pour soutenir son auteur et l'encourager à écrire de nouveaux articles ...

 

Cet article vous est proposé par Domotics: Domotics habite dans la région Toulousaine. Il est ingénieur en informatique et électronicien amateur. La domotique est pour lui une passion qu'il pratique depuis 1999. En 2003, il décide de partager ses expériences sur le magazine et le forum de touteladomotique.com.

En 2014, il crée sa société de conseils en Domotique ID2domotique.com et sa boutique en ligne laboutiquededomotique.com. Profitez de l'expérience et l'expertise de Domotics en faisant appel à ses services. Les conseils sont gratuits ...

Mise à jour le Mardi, 12 Novembre 2013 22:55